dc.description.abstract Water (chemical formula: H2O) is a transparent fluid which forms the world's streams, lakes, oceans and rain, and is the major constituent of the fluids of organisms. As a chemical compound, a water molecule contains one oxygen and two hydrogen atoms that are connected by covalent bonds. Water is a liquid at standard ambient temperature and pressure, but it often co- exists on Earth with its solid state, ice; and gaseous state, steam (water vapour). Even today man has brought about changes whether through urbanisation and growth of population centre by introduction and employment of auxiliary means in agriculture which has disturbed or destroyed the natural healthy quality of water bodies. en_US
